For those interested in skydiving, understanding the safety measures and training is crucial. Typically, beginners start with tandem jumps, where a professional instructor guides and controls the jump to increase safety. The experience can be both exhilarating and nerve-wracking, and even the most experienced jumpers acknowledge the importance of preparation, weather considerations, and physical fitness.
